在當今信息化的時代,數(shù)據(jù)已經(jīng)成為企業(yè)運作的核心資產(chǎn),而數(shù)據(jù)庫則是管理這些數(shù)據(jù)的重要工具。數(shù)據(jù)庫文件的損壞或丟失時有發(fā)生,導致業(yè)務運營中斷,甚至帶來巨大的經(jīng)濟損失。因此,數(shù)據(jù)庫文件恢復變得尤為重要。本文將探討數(shù)據(jù)庫文件損壞的常見原因及其恢復方法,幫助企業(yè)更好地維護數(shù)據(jù)的完整性和安全性。
數(shù)據(jù)庫文件損壞的常見原因
硬件故障
硬件故障是導致數(shù)據(jù)庫文件損壞的主要原因之一。磁盤驅(qū)動器損壞、電源故障或內(nèi)存錯誤都可能導致數(shù)據(jù)無法正確寫入或讀取,進而引發(fā)數(shù)據(jù)庫損壞。硬件老化或受到物理損壞也會對數(shù)據(jù)庫的正常運行產(chǎn)生影響。
軟件錯誤
軟件錯誤同樣會導致數(shù)據(jù)庫文件損壞,包括操作系統(tǒng)崩潰、數(shù)據(jù)庫管理系統(tǒng)(如MySQL、SQLServer等)中的BUG或軟件更新失敗。這些問題可能會導致數(shù)據(jù)文件被錯誤地修改或部分丟失,使得數(shù)據(jù)庫無法正常訪問。
人為錯誤
人為操作失誤,如誤刪除數(shù)據(jù)文件、意外格式化硬盤、誤操作數(shù)據(jù)庫命令等,也是造成數(shù)據(jù)丟失的常見原因。這種情況通常沒有明顯的預警信號,一旦發(fā)生往往難以挽回。
惡意攻擊或病毒感染
黑客攻擊和病毒感染會導致數(shù)據(jù)庫文件被加密、篡改或刪除,尤其是勒索軟件攻擊會鎖定重要數(shù)據(jù)文件,并要求高額贖金才能解密。這類惡意攻擊造成的數(shù)據(jù)丟失問題愈加頻繁,嚴重威脅著企業(yè)的數(shù)據(jù)安全。
數(shù)據(jù)庫文件恢復的方法
針對數(shù)據(jù)庫文件損壞或丟失的情況,有多種恢復方法可供選擇。下面將介紹幾種常見的數(shù)據(jù)庫文件恢復技術:
從備份文件中恢復
定期備份是保障數(shù)據(jù)安全的最基本措施。一旦數(shù)據(jù)庫文件損壞,可以通過備份文件快速恢復至正常狀態(tài)。備份文件的時間和質(zhì)量直接決定了恢復的效果。因此,建議企業(yè)制定詳細的備份策略,定期執(zhí)行完整備份和差異備份,以減少數(shù)據(jù)丟失的風險。
使用數(shù)據(jù)庫恢復工具
市面上有許多專業(yè)的數(shù)據(jù)庫恢復工具,可以幫助用戶掃描損壞的數(shù)據(jù)庫文件,并嘗試修復數(shù)據(jù)。這些工具通常具備多種恢復模式,如快速恢復、深度恢復等,可根據(jù)實際情況選擇最合適的恢復方式。例如,EaseUS、DiskDrill等都是常用的數(shù)據(jù)恢復軟件。
數(shù)據(jù)庫恢復工具在某些情況下非常有效,但并非萬能。如果文件損壞嚴重,可能無法完全恢復所有數(shù)據(jù)。使用恢復工具時,還需注意避免二次破壞數(shù)據(jù)。
高級恢復方法
當備份文件不可用或數(shù)據(jù)庫恢復工具無法解決問題時,可以考慮一些更為復雜的高級恢復方法。
數(shù)據(jù)庫日志分析
數(shù)據(jù)庫系統(tǒng)通常會記錄日志文件,記錄了每一次數(shù)據(jù)操作的詳細信息。通過分析這些日志文件,可以嘗試手動還原數(shù)據(jù)。盡管這種方法耗時較長,需要對數(shù)據(jù)庫系統(tǒng)有深入了解,但在某些緊急情況下,它可以成為最后的救命稻草。
專業(yè)數(shù)據(jù)恢復服務
如果企業(yè)缺乏相關技術能力,可以選擇求助專業(yè)的數(shù)據(jù)恢復公司。這些公司擁有先進的恢復設備和經(jīng)驗豐富的技術人員,能夠在多種極端情況下恢復數(shù)據(jù),如物理硬件損壞或病毒感染導致的數(shù)據(jù)丟失。雖然成本較高,但這種方法在關鍵數(shù)據(jù)恢復時非常值得考慮。
預防數(shù)據(jù)庫文件損壞的措施
數(shù)據(jù)庫文件損壞帶來的損失不可忽視,因此,預防措施必不可少。以下是一些有效的預防措施:
定期備份數(shù)據(jù)
數(shù)據(jù)備份是預防數(shù)據(jù)丟失的基本手段,建議企業(yè)至少每天進行一次自動備份,并妥善保存?zhèn)浞菸募北尽?梢詫浞菸募鎯υ诓煌奈锢砦恢茫蚴褂迷贫舜鎯σ蕴岣甙踩浴?/p>
硬件和軟件維護
保持服務器和數(shù)據(jù)庫管理系統(tǒng)的穩(wěn)定性,定期進行硬件檢測和軟件更新。應為服務器配置UPS(不間斷電源),以防止意外斷電導致的數(shù)據(jù)丟失。
加強安全防護
設置防火墻和殺毒軟件,定期進行安全漏洞檢測。尤其要注意防范勒索軟件攻擊,并為員工提供數(shù)據(jù)安全培訓,提高全員的安全意識。
通過以上措施,企業(yè)可以在最大程度上預防數(shù)據(jù)庫文件損壞,同時建立高效的應急恢復方案,在數(shù)據(jù)丟失時快速恢復業(yè)務,減少損失。數(shù)據(jù)庫文件恢復是數(shù)據(jù)管理中不可忽視的重要環(huán)節(jié),需要企業(yè)高度重視并不斷完善策略。